Share via


ConnectToSourceOracleSyncTaskOutput Class

  • java.lang.Object
    • com.azure.resourcemanager.datamigration.models.ConnectToSourceOracleSyncTaskOutput

Implements

public final class ConnectToSourceOracleSyncTaskOutput
implements JsonSerializable<ConnectToSourceOracleSyncTaskOutput>

Output for the task that validates Oracle database connection.

Constructor Summary

Constructor Description
ConnectToSourceOracleSyncTaskOutput()

Creates an instance of ConnectToSourceOracleSyncTaskOutput class.

Method Summary

Modifier and Type Method and Description
List<String> databases()

Get the databases property: List of schemas on source server.

static ConnectToSourceOracleSyncTaskOutput fromJson(JsonReader jsonReader)

Reads an instance of ConnectToSourceOracleSyncTaskOutput from the JsonReader.

String sourceServerBrandVersion()

Get the sourceServerBrandVersion property: Source server brand version.

String sourceServerVersion()

Get the sourceServerVersion property: Version of the source server.

JsonWriter toJson(JsonWriter jsonWriter)
void validate()

Validates the instance.

List<ReportableException> validationErrors()

Get the validationErrors property: Validation errors associated with the task.

Methods inherited from java.lang.Object

Constructor Details

ConnectToSourceOracleSyncTaskOutput

public ConnectToSourceOracleSyncTaskOutput()

Creates an instance of ConnectToSourceOracleSyncTaskOutput class.

Method Details

databases

public List<String> databases()

Get the databases property: List of schemas on source server.

Returns:

the databases value.

fromJson

public static ConnectToSourceOracleSyncTaskOutput fromJson(JsonReader jsonReader)

Reads an instance of ConnectToSourceOracleSyncTaskOutput from the JsonReader.

Parameters:

jsonReader - The JsonReader being read.

Returns:

An instance of ConnectToSourceOracleSyncTaskOutput if the JsonReader was pointing to an instance of it, or null if it was pointing to JSON null.

Throws:

IOException

- If an error occurs while reading the ConnectToSourceOracleSyncTaskOutput.

sourceServerBrandVersion

public String sourceServerBrandVersion()

Get the sourceServerBrandVersion property: Source server brand version.

Returns:

the sourceServerBrandVersion value.

sourceServerVersion

public String sourceServerVersion()

Get the sourceServerVersion property: Version of the source server.

Returns:

the sourceServerVersion value.

toJson

public JsonWriter toJson(JsonWriter jsonWriter)

Parameters:

jsonWriter

Throws:

validate

public void validate()

Validates the instance.

validationErrors

public List<ReportableException> validationErrors()

Get the validationErrors property: Validation errors associated with the task.

Returns:

the validationErrors value.

Applies to